Content
- 14th Annual Utah Conference on Energy, Mixing and New Technology, Sept. 7, 1990:G.P. Cold nuclear Fusion. A great gift to the XXI Century? Handwritten notes. G.P., Mass in the standard model, Meeting on General Relativity Tests, Commemoration of W. Fairbank, Rome (Italy), September 1990 (MITH 91/14, transparencies). G.P., S.S. Xue, Do we live on a lattice? Fermion masses from the Planck mass, Physics Letters B", vol. 264, n. 1-2 (1991), pp. 35-38; G.P., S.S. Xue, A possible massive solution to dyson-equation with small gauge coupling (LNF- 92/059, June 24, 1992); G.P., S.S. Xue, The standard model on a planck lattice: emergence of the tt-condensate and disappearance of the Higgs particle (LNF-92/012, Feb. 26, 1992); G.P., S.S. Xue, Fermion masses from the planck mass (LNF-92/002, Jan 15, 1992).Letter from G.P., P. Ratcliffe to R. Gatto (Milan, April 16, 1992). Letter from G.P. to R. Gatto (Milan, Oct. 14, 1992).
